      德国腓德烈港国际汽车改装技术博览会(TUNING WORLD BODENSEE)是专业的国际汽车改装及生活方式和改装俱乐部现场活动展览会,是欧洲最大的汽车改装产业展,展会从2003年开始举办,每年一届在腓德烈港博登湖边举行,同期举行的Car+Sound汽车音响博览会。近几年新兴的德国Tuning World Bodensee改装车展,除了可看到酷炫的改装车外,每年还会举办Miss Tuning。

      18SZ图片处理

      Tuning World Bodensee为当前欧洲最大的汽车改装产业展,参展的企业超过200多家,有超过上千辆酷炫的改装车。与Tuning World Bodensee共同举办的 Miss Tuning,有来自各地的几百位佳丽参赛,进入决选的仅有20位,而最后获得后冠的女郎,将可获得Seat Ibiza SC一整年的访问权,并担任改装车工业的亲善大使。为了宣传Tuning World Bodensee改装车大展,每年主办单位都会拍摄一辑非常性感的《Miss Tuning Calender》香车美女图片作为日历的素材。

      展会报告(Show Reports):

      Friedrichshafen – Tuning World Bodensee went all out in 2025, with over 112,000 visitors flocking to Friedrichshafen to experience a trade show of superlatives and a defining event for the tuning community. With over 1000 show cars, more than 700 participants from the tuning industry, event world, and community, a wide-ranging supporting program, and sold-out after-show parties on Friday and Saturday night, the exhibition offered four days that were simply unforgettable. “The event proved once again that it’s one of the most important international gatherings for the tuning and car club community. As a key date at the start of the season, it brings together professionals and enthusiasts, fosters dialogue about trends and innovations, and fuels a shared passion for custom vehicles. With overwhelming visitor turnout and an expanded show program, Tuning World Bodensee was a complete success for exhibitors and a major celebration for the community,” said Messe Friedrichshafen CEO Klaus Wellmann and Project Manager Emanuela Botta in their wrap-up of the event.

      Action, celebrities, and thrilling showdowns at the ETS

      Night drifting sessions, complete with spectacular light and fire shows, created an electrifying atmosphere, while the European Tuning Showdown (ETS) competitors left expert judges sweating bullets over tough decisions. Nail-biting head-to-head battles made it very difficult to pick a winner. In the end, James Rudland of Great Britain took first place with his 356 Outlaw. Second place went to Antonio Lafata of Italy with his Porsche 997 “BTS-Indecent,” and Werner Kreiner of Germany placed third with his Plymouth AAR Cuda “Aarow.” “We dedicated an entire year to bringing the finest cars from across Europe to Friedrichshafen. In the meantime, if you just mention the words ‘Lake Constance’ or ‘Tuning World,’ then those who build such cars know that this is the place to be for the tuning scene,” reports ETS organizer and tuning expert Sven Schulz. “Tuning is driven by the people involved, their emotions, and the strong sense of community. based on the visitor feedback, we’ve managed to raise the bar again this year – especially in terms of international participation. That fills us with pride, even though we are merely the platform that brings these incredibly talented people together. The great thing about the ETS is the tuners from all over Europe who make the line-up so unique.”

      Exhibiting companies extremely satisfied

      “For us, Tuning World Bodensee is clearly our ‘in-house’ exhibition. It has been a venue where we have enjoyed a home-field advantage for many years. The audience this year was excellent, and I can definitely say that everything went well throughout,” says Florian Johann, Brand Manager at KW Automotive GmbH, reflecting on the recent days at the fair. Karl Geiger, founder and Managing Director of Geiger Cars, was especially pleased to see so many young visitors. “It’s encouraging to see young people taking an interest in mechanical pursuits rather than just focusing on Instagram. You can make a splash here with a great car, cool paintwork, impressive exhaust systems, and stylish rims. We had lots of customers at our booth throughout the event.” Björn Beisheim, Team Lead at Vogtland Autosport GmbH, echoed the positive sentiment: “It’s simply an outstanding event in every regard. For me personally, Tuning World Bodensee is all about emotions, fun, and simply having a good time. Having the fair venue situated in the tri-border region of Germany, Austria, and Switzerland also gives us a chance to connect with customers we wouldn’t normally reach from our home base in Hagen.” Dirk Hattenhauer, Marketing Manager at Sonax, also reported great results: “Our Sonax booth was packed, and sales were outstanding. Visitors showed a real interest in car care, which really motivated our team to go all out.”
